Why Nozzle Clogging Happens in Inner & Collector Nozzle Systems

Nozzle clogging in inner and collector nozzle systems poses a critical challenge for professionals and businesses alike. Understanding why this issue occurs is paramount, as it can lead to significant operational inefficiencies and production downtimes. When a nozzle system fails to discharge fluids or materials because of clogs, it not only delays production but also escalates maintenance costs and compromises the integrity of the final product. For industries reliant on precision and efficiency—like manufacturing, agriculture, and food processing—the ramifications are far-reaching. When I consider the stakes involved, the urgency to address nozzle clogging becomes clear: neglected nozzles can disrupt entire workflows and lead to cascading failures in production lines.

To dissect the issue, we must analyze the primary causes of nozzle clogging. Various factors contribute to this phenomenon, including:

  • Debris Accumulation: Small particles and contaminants can accumulate in the nozzle, obstructing flow.
  • Inconsistent Fluid Properties: Variations in viscosity or density can change how materials interact within the nozzle.
  • Improper Calibration: Nozzles need to operate at specific tolerances—precision to 0.01mm is common. Any deviation can lead to misalignment and subsequent blockages.
  • Aging Infrastructure: Older equipment is prone to wear and tear, which can exacerbate clogging issues.
